数据仓库(Data Warehouse)是企业级的数据存储结构,用于支持大型决策支持系统(DSS)和商业智能(BI)应用程序。数据仓库不同于传统的数据库系统,它维护着大量历史数据和时间序列数据,同时也提供了一个方便的数据访问接口,方便用户对数据进行各种分析、汇总和挖掘。下面我们来探讨一下数据仓库的典型特点。
1. 面向主题
数据仓库的主要目标是支持企业级的决策支持和商业智能应用程序。因此,数据仓库的设计是围绕着企业各个主题展开的。主题是数据仓库所包含的数据的一类抽象概念,具有一定的业务背景,通常是基于公司角色、业务流程、产品或客户等方面而定义的。例如,客户主题、销售主题、订单主题等等。这种面向主题的设计方式,能够满足复杂的查询需求,使企业的决策制定变得更加科学。
2. 集成性
数据仓库不仅仅包括企业内部的数据,还包括从外部获取的数据,例如供应商、市场调查等。这些数据可能来自不同的数据库、文件系统或者应用程序,都需要进行数据集成和清洗,使得存储在数据仓库中的数据是高质量和一致的,容易被用户理解和使用。
3. 历史性
数据仓库通常维护着大量历史数据和时间序列数据,以支持时间分析。例如,用户可以查询在不同时间段内公司的销售数据,或者分析两个季度之间的销售趋势变化。历史数据的维护需要考虑到数据的存储、备份和版本控制等问题。
4. 可扩展性
企业数据通常不断累积增加,因此,数据仓库需要具有可扩展性。数据仓库应该能够承载持续增长的数据量并保持良好的性能,同时,也应该具备可扩展性以供未来的数据增量和硬件升级。
5. 易用性
数据仓库需要提供一个方便的数据访问接口,以方便用户进行各种分析、汇总和挖掘。这个接口应该是易用的、直观的,能够支持用户友好的查询和分析。同时,数据仓库还应该提供一些通用的工具和应用程序,以方便用户进行数据分析、报告和可视化。
综上所述,数据仓库具有面向主题、集成性、历史性、可扩展性和易用性等典型特点。它能够为企业的决策者提供准确、可靠的数据支持,帮助企业在商业竞争中获得优势。随着数据分析和人工智能的普及,数据仓库也将会成为企业决策的重要保障。
扫码咨询 领取资料